I’m looking to ideally sell, though will consider TRADE (+cash either way if needs be).
Bought from the forum earlier this year - my 4th from this forum.
The great ranking on PinSide, the highest multiplier in pinball (x84) and 2nd only to TSPP on rule set - plus the fear of the impending lockdowns made this a great 4th addition …..unfortunately, I’ve discovered I'm not a Tolkienite, and while I do enjoy playing it, with its plenty of shots – both long and short and call-outs, it just doesn't resonate with me. Plus, there’s something about players wanting to get to Valinor..... I have no idea who or what Valinor is
So...
the machine plays perfectly and is mechanically and electronically sound (No significant playfield wear that I can see.
The cabinet is sound, has a few dings (mainly to backbox) and scuffs as you'd expect from an almost 18 year old machine.
This is a UK skill post version, albeit disabled and button holes covered with half moon protectors. Coils are still present - if you want to reinstate them.
The details:
CABINET-
wear around the body/leg area incl. odd scrape. Colour is strong. Front with decal fitted.
Legs powder coated a bronze colour (front only) + gold coloured bolts and leg levellers fitted. Stern metal body protectors also fitted.
Side rails, half-moon protectors, lockdown bar and shooter housing all gold powder coated - all the remaining armour basically.
New gold shooter rod, spring and handle.
Alternative translight.
Remote battery holder fitted.
PLAYFIELD and EXTRAS-
No significant playfield wear that I can see.
Upgraded LOTR flipper coils - these are a HUGE improvement on the factory fitted ones and a necessity so you can continue making those full length long ring shots (especially with all the multiballs you get in this game) without loosing power, and to get to Valinor.
Side blades. Ok, but a little tatty in 1 place, but not so noticeable while playing – or simply remove them.
Palantir mod - glass ball with colour changing LED and colour changing underpay field LED.
3D printed Palantir target support - no more wonky target.
Couple of figures have their weapons missing which is common for this game.
The odd cracked plastic. (Have since fitted Colywobbles plastic protectors to most, to future protect [and they looks bloody great!]).
Alternative translite.
The sword rail has been professionally polished (rather than the dull brushed steel).
Hidden full length flasher under sword (flashes with jets).
POTD guide + additional post to guide the ball in to lane and away from the infamous Arwen plastic.
Some LEDS and some incandescent bulbs depending on position. I thought they better matched the theme + added some colour.
New flipper bands and some other rubbers.
Light mod added under the POTD (dark area).
Gandalf light staff mod added.
Couple of unfitted cliffys + 2 x door stickers included.
Pincup not included (only JUST got that!)
Think that's it all. Bit wordy, but hopefully full picture.
